From 781b21dc51714629bd856b09e6a47dfcc565e14c Mon Sep 17 00:00:00 2001 From: Rob Kaufman Date: Tue, 18 Jun 2024 14:14:12 -0700 Subject: [PATCH] fix bug from parent addition refactor --- app/factories/bulkrax/object_factory.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/factories/bulkrax/object_factory.rb b/app/factories/bulkrax/object_factory.rb index ac45cb71..35c7ca8a 100644 --- a/app/factories/bulkrax/object_factory.rb +++ b/app/factories/bulkrax/object_factory.rb @@ -12,7 +12,7 @@ class ObjectFactory < ObjectFactoryInterface # @note This does not save either object. We need to do that in another # loop. Why? Because we might be adding many items to the parent. def self.add_child_to_parent_work(parent:, child:) - return true if parent.ordered_members.to_a.include?(child_record) + return true if parent.ordered_members.to_a.include?(child) parent.ordered_members << child end